March 25, 2026
Ron DiCarlantonio | Cognitive Workload, AI Assistants and the Provable ROI of Better Fleet Driver Experience
<p><strong>08. Ron DiCarlantonio (iNago) | Cognitive Workload, AI Assistants and the Provable ROI of Better Fleet Driver Experience</strong></p><p>Ron DiCarlantonio is the President and Founder of iNago. He also played an important role in the development of Tweddle Group's AVA platform. Ron knows AI assistants, from the expectations bring to their AI interactions to the back-end arbitration that keeps these systems accurate and honest. Having worked with in-vehicle AI for the last few years, Ron's got valuable insights into cognitive workload, and how voice assistants might help minimize distraction while making drivers more informed. </p><p>Ron sat down with Inside Information Host Laura McGowan to discuss his latest project, a push toward in-cabin assistants for fleet truck operators. Could in-cabin assistants improve logistics, maintenance <strong>and</strong> overall management for fleet owners? Ron makes a compelling argument.</p><p>He also introduces <strong>MUTUALISM</strong>, an industry consortium establishing an open, standardized platform for next-gen in-vehicle experience.
